-- Show OSD clock
--
-- Shows OSD clock periodicaly with many configurable options,
-- OSD options like duration, alignment, border, scale could be set in ~/.config/mpv/mpv.conf
-- OSD-clock configurable options:
-- interval ... how often to show OSD clock, either seconds or human friendly format like '1h 33m 5s' is supported (default '15m')
-- format ... date format string (default "%H:%M")
-- duration ... how long [in seconds] OSD stays, fractional values supported (default 1.2)
-- key ... to bind show OSD clock on request (false for no binding; default 'h' key)
-- name ... symbolic name (can be used in input.conf, see mpv doc for details; default 'show-clock')
--
-- To customize configuration place osd-clock.conf into ~/.config/mpv/lua-settings/ and edit
--
-- Place script into ~/.config/mpv/scripts/ for autoload
--
-- GitHub: https://github.com/blue-sky-r/mpv/tree/master/scripts
local options = require("mp.options")
local utils = require("mp.utils")
-- defaults
local cfg = {
interval = '15m',
format = "%H:%M",
duration = 2.5,
key = 'h',
name = 'show-clock'
}
-- human readable time format to seconds: 15m 3s -> 903
local function htime2sec(hstr)
local s = tonumber(hstr)
-- only number withoout units
if s then return s end
-- human units h,m,s to seconds
local hu = {h=60*60, m=60, s=1}
s = 0
for unit,mult in pairs(hu) do
local _,_,num = string.find(hstr, "(%d+)"..unit)
if num then
s = s + tonumber(num)*mult
end
end
return s
end
-- calc aligned timeout in sec
local function aligned_timeout(align)
local time = os.time()
local atout = align * math.ceil(time / align) - time
return atout
end
-- read lua-settings/osd-clock.conf
options.read_options(cfg, 'osd-clock')
-- log active config
mp.msg.verbose('cfg = '..utils.to_string(cfg))
-- OSD show clock
local function osd_clock()
local s = os.date(cfg.format)
mp.osd_message(s, cfg.duration)
end
-- non empty interval enables osd clock
if cfg.interval then
-- log
mp.msg.info('interval:'..cfg.interval..', format:'..cfg.format)
-- osd timer
local osd_timer = mp.add_periodic_timer( htime2sec(cfg.interval), osd_clock)
osd_timer:stop()
-- start osd timer exactly at interval boundary
local delay = aligned_timeout( htime2sec( cfg.interval))
-- delayed start
mp.add_timeout(delay,
function()
osd_timer:resume()
osd_clock()
end
)
-- log startup delay for osd timer
mp.msg.verbose('for osd_interval:'..cfg.interval..' calculated startup delay:'..delay)
-- optional bind to the key
if cfg.key then
mp.add_key_binding(cfg.key, cfg.name, osd_clock)
-- log binding
mp.msg.verbose("key:'"..cfg.key.."' bound to '"..cfg.name.."'")
end
end
